Ve. Belskii et al., THE INFLUENCE OF DETERGENTLESS MICROEMULSION ON THE KINETICS OF HYDROLYSIS OF DI(P-NITROPHENYL) METHYLPHOSPHONATE CATALYZED BY AMINES, Russian chemical bulletin, 47(7), 1998, pp. 1302-1305
The influence of the detergentless water/oil microemulsion formed in t
he n-hexane-water-2-propanol system on the kinetics of the hydrolysis
of di(p-nitrophenyl) methyrphosphonate under the conditions of general
base catalysis by primary, secondary, and tertiary aliphatic amines w
as investigated. The leveling of the catalytic rate constants and basi
cities of the amines was found for this reaction in a microemulsion. T
he catalytic rate constants for the amines containing hydrophilic grou
ps increase in microemulsions as compared to those in an aqueous mediu
m, while the catalytic constants for the amines containing hydrophobic
groups decrease.
